Its been a couple of years since I had to deal with this but if I remember correctly someone needs to swap in the 80E segment file into your current tuning file. I wound up finding a 3/4 ton truck with a 6L/4L80E file that matched the year of my truck and my tuner took it from there. Not sure if its been made easier lately but obtaining a 3/4 ton truck file might be an option for you.
